A Master of Project Management (MPM or MSc in Project Management) program in Malaysia is a postgraduate degree designed to equip professionals with advanced knowledge, tools, and techniques to lead and deliver projects across diverse industries effectively. This program is crucial in today's dynamic business environment, where effective project management is key to organizational success and innovation.

The curriculum typically covers core project management knowledge areas such as project integration management, scope management, schedule management, cost management, quality management, resource management, communications management, risk management, and procurement management. Many programs in Malaysia incorporate international standards like the Project Management Body of Knowledge (PMBOK® Guide) and delve into contemporary topics like Agile project management, strategic project management, and leadership. Emphasis is placed on developing critical thinking, problem-solving, and decision-making skills through case studies, simulations, and real-world projects, often culminating in a dissertation or capstone project.

Graduates with a Master of Project Management are highly sought after across various sectors, including IT, construction, engineering, finance, healthcare, and consulting. Career prospects are robust, with roles such as project manager, program director, project coordinator, project consultant, and even senior leadership positions like chief project officer. Many programs are accredited by global bodies like the Project Management Institute (PMI) Global Accreditation Center (GAC), providing substantial credit for professional certifications like PMP.

Course Structure/ What You’ll Learn:

This program comprises 12 coursework modules and a project. There are 10 compulsory Core Modules (including the research methodology module), and you will have to choose 1 pathway with 2 elective modules from those listed

Prerequisite Modules (for non-business students)
Duration: 1 month (Full-time) / 2 months (Part-time)

Managing People
Understanding Customers
Managerial Finance
Business Environment & Strategic Planning
Core Modules

Project Quality Management
Project Development and Scope Management
Project Planning and Scheduling
Research Methodology
Project Cost Estimation and Budgeting
Principles and Practices of Project Management
Communication and Stakeholder Management
Project Procurement Contract Management
Project HR and Leadership
Project Risk Management
Project
Elective Modules 1 (Analytical Decision-Making Pathway)*

Strategic Planning and Systems Development
Quantitative Methods for Decision Making
Or

Elective Modules 2 (Management Pathway)*

Managing Creativity and Innovation
Managing Organisations
Or

Elective Modules 3 (Digitalisation Pathway)*

Digital Execution
Digital Project Management
